Output 42e29758215571a6e0815dee0501c179b66d6daf1535d31c29ae4a7e1d3869e2:1

value
344140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95004981a640aa1bdc4432e94072869d935cbdb OP_EQUAL
address
3L3Tbr2G5BpewtiMax5DWkj3P3tMMSd6Wp
transaction
42e29758215571a6e0815dee0501c179b66d6daf1535d31c29ae4a7e1d3869e2
confirmations
416306
spent
true